RubyKaigi 2025 will be at Matsuyama, Japan, Apr 16th - 18th.
We would like to try to hold a face-to-face dev meeting at Matsuyama. (@matz will also participate!)

* Date: 2025/04/15 (Tue.) 16:00-19:00 (The day before RubyKaigi)
* Location: Ehime-ken Sogo Shakai Fukushi Kaikan, 3F Training room
  (in Japanese) 愛媛県総合社会福祉会館3F 研修室


### How to participate

Open to any RubyKaigi attendees who have a commit bit or who have a topic they particularly want to discuss.
Please sign up on the doorkeeper page:
https://rubyassociation.doorkeeper.jp/events/181721

The meeting will be held in a hackathon event.
Please enjoy Ruby hacking with friends if you want before the meeting.

Note: Do not forget to register RubyKaigi ticket too (see "[ruby-core:120816] Invitation to RubyKaigi 2025" from Akira).

### Program

* 10:00am door open and start the Hackathon event
* 3:00pm(?) Matz will arrive
* 4:00pm opening and self introduction
* 4:30pm discuss topics
* 6:00pm closing and free time (closing time is depends on topics)
* 7:00pm door close


### Call for agenda items

If you have a ticket that you want matz and committers to discuss, please post it into this ticket in the following format:

```
* [Ticket ref] Ticket title (your name)
  * Comment (A summary of the ticket, why you put this ticket here, what point should be discussed, etc.)
```

Example:

```
* [Feature #14609] `Kernel#p` without args shows the receiver (ko1)
  * I feel this feature is very useful and some people say :+1: so let discuss this feature.
```

- It is recommended to add a comment by 2025/04/10. I'll ask Matz which should be discussed on this meeting and reorder them.
- The format is strict.  We'll use [this script to automatically create an markdown-style agenda](https://gist.github.com/mame/b0390509ce1491b43610b9ebb665eb86).  We may ignore a comment that does not follow the format.
- Your comment is mandatory. We cannot read all discussion of the ticket in a limited time. We appreciate it if you could write a short summary and update from a previous discussion.

* [Feature #21216] Implement Set as a core class (jeremyevans0)
  * I propose to implement Set as a core class.
  * I have a pull request that adds a value-less `st_table` (named `set_table`), for a 33% memory savings.
  * Core Set speeds up the majority of Set methods, with 47% of benchmarked cases being at least twice as fast.
  * Open questions are:
    * How to expose this in the C-API.
    * Whether to share types with `st.c` (currently, all types are renamed from `st_*` to `set_*`).
    * Where the code should live (potentially `st.c` if types are shared).
    * Where to use this internally (potentially, fstring table and proposed refinement call cache).

* [Feature #21221] Proposal to upstream ZJIT
  * The YJIT team has been working on ZJIT, a more advanced Ruby JIT
  * We aim for this JIT to be in a usable state in time for 3.5
  * We would like to discuss upstreaming it after RubyKaigi to make development easier

* [Feature #21254] Inline YARV instructions for `Class#new`
  * Patch inlines YARV instructions for calls to `new`
  * Allocation performance is very good (24% faster, at minimum but reaches 3x depending on parameters)
  * Memory usage increases but not significantly 
  * `caller` changes inside `initialize`

* [Feature #21219] `Object#inspect` accept a list of instance variables to display (byroot)
  * Redefining `#inspect` can be important to avoid secret leak or to avoid very large `inspect` representations
  * Right now implementing a custom `#inspect` isn't as simple as it seems (e.g. circular references, object_id, etc)
  * Should we make it easy to keep the default `#inspect` but hide some instance variables?

* [Feature #21262] Proposal: `Ractor::Port` (ko1)
  * Considering with [`Channel`](https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/21121), `Port` concept seems better for me.
  * I found that `take`/`yield` is so difficult to implement correctly and efficiently enough to support `Ractor.select` in 4 years, so I'm voting to remove them.
